Located at the heart of New Cross, the station offers a wide range of amenities designed to make your travel experience as seamless as possible. The ticket office is operational from early morning to late evening—Monday to Friday from 06:45 until 19:15, Saturday from 06:10 to 20:00, and Sunday from 08:30 to 20:00. For added convenience, there are ticket machines where you can also collect tickets purchased online, including accessible machines located at the station forecourt and booking hall.
Smartcards are an excellent way to streamline your travels, and New Cross issues and validates these cards for your ease. The station provides a secure environment with CCTV surveillance and help points that ensure assistance is always at hand from early morning till midnight. However, if you're traveling with luggage, be mindful that there are no storage facilities, so plan accordingly.
The station has made significant strides in ensuring that it caters to passengers with additional accessibility needs. While parts of the station offer step-free access, more detailed checks are recommended as platforms A and B can be accessed via lifts, and there are short but steep ramps from some entrances. There are also accessible toilets and a ramp available for train access, making your travel as comfortable as possible.
For those with bicycles, New Cross offers 22 storage spaces on Platform C, although they are unsheltered and use is at your own risk. If you're thinking of cycling through London, remember that there are no cycle hire facilities at this station. On the tech side, public Wi-Fi might not be available, but pay phones ensure you're never out of touch.

Bache station is equipped to cater to your travelling needs with a variety of features focused on customer support and accessibility. While there is no traditional ticket office, the station facilitates efficient travel with its accessible ticket machines that are compliant with Disability Discrimination Act (DDA) standards. Moreover, the presence of an induction loop ensures hearing aid users have a seamless experience when purchasing tickets.
Although staff assistance isn’t readily available at Bache, customer support needs are aptly met through dedicated help points and clear informational displays detailing departures and arrivals. It's noteworthy, however, that there are no public toilets or refreshment facilities, so planning ahead is advised.
Considering the needs of passengers with reduced mobility, Bache station provides step-free access to some areas, though assistance should be booked in advance due to its unstaffed nature. The station prides itself on offering 61 parking spaces, including three accessible spaces, ensuring rider convenience. With CCTV in place, your vehicle’s safety is prioritized as you travel.
Bache station offers robust travel connections via rail replacement services and various modes of transport. To assist in your onward journey, buses connecting to Chester and Liverpool are available, with stops conveniently located near the hospital's subway or on Mill Lane. For those heading to the airport, a combined train and bus ticket can be a seamless choice for reaching Liverpool John Lennon Airport with ease.
If you need further assistance planning your trip, the Traveline service is just a call away at 0871 200 2233, facilitating smooth travel across the network.
